Conquering the IAPP CIPM Exam: A Comprehensive Guide

Earning the Certified Information Privacy Manager (CIPM) designation from the International Association of Privacy Professionals (IAPP) is a testament to your expertise in information privacy. The CIPM exam, however, can be a tough undertaking. To navigate this intensive assessment and achieve your certification, a well-structured and comprehensive study plan is vital.

  • Start by familiarizing the CIPM exam blueprint. This document outlines the major domains and subjects covered on the exam.
  • Pinpoint your knowledge gaps through practice questions. This will help you focus your study resources where they are urgently needed.
  • Leverage a variety of study resources, including official IAPP guides, online tutorials, and practice exams.

Establish a realistic study schedule that allows for consistent practice sessions. Aim to revisit all exam areas multiple times before the assessment.
